The Finnish Music Information Centre reports that the brilliant vocalist Sanna Kurki-Suonio (Hedningarna) is in a new international group called SANS, along with Andrew Cronshaw, Ian Blake and Tigran Aleksanyan: https://www.fimic.fi/fimic/fimic.nsf/0/047C0D764BC11BB0C22579220045029C?opendocument
Look for their debut album "The unbroken surface of snow", out soon under Cronshaw's name.
Danish band Plastic Horse will release their debut EP "Real doesn't exist" on November 9 via , the label of fellow Danish artist Marie Frank. The band is fronted by J.S. Knudsen, a trained social anthropologist, who says that the music contained therein is "based on ethnographic studies of the effect of technology, religion and power have on human relations" and thus is "implicitly political." Hear samples at the band's website: https://plastichorse.dk/
The music doesn't live up to such bold proclamations to my ears, but I can't fault them for trying.
On October 28, Norwegian artist Egil Olsen (nee Uncle's Institution) will be releasing a new live album entitled "Egil Olsen show". Samples and details here: https://www.egilolsen.com/eos.htm
Egil will also be releasing his most recent studio album "Keep movin - keep dreamin'" on vinyl that same day, along with his solo debut "I am a singer/songwriter", making his entire discography finally all available on wax.

is compiling Darkthrone's first four early demos from the years 1988-1989 ("Land of frost", "A new dimension", "Thulcandra") and will be releasing them as a restored/remastered 2LP set under the title "Sempiternal past". The official release date is November 14.
